E-ONE's Tradition TyphoonŽ HP 75 features an extruded aluminum ladder that exceeds NFPA's 1901 requirements with a 2.5 to 1 structural safety factor**. In addition, the aerial will not rust or need painting. And with no rung covers to replace, the HP 75 delivers the lowest life-cycle cost of any aerial. With generous compartmentation, ground ladder storage, hosebed and tank size, the Tradition HP 75 outperforms, out maneuvers and costs less to maintain than the competition.
**Based on the Aluminum Association's Aluminum Design Manual, 2000 edition
Highlights:
- TyphoonŽ chassis
- 154 cu. ft. of NFPA compartment storage
- 75' aluminum ladder with 2.5 to 1 structural safety factor
- 500-lb. tip load wet or dry plus 50 lbs. for equipment
- 500-gallon tank
- Fly section over 25" wide to allow for stokes basket
- 55 cu. ft. SideStackerŽ hosebed with capacity of 800-1000' 5" LDH & 300'-3" DJ
- Storage for 115' of ground ladders
